DONALD Trump was elected the 47th president of the United States on Wednesday, an extraordinary comeback for a former president who refused to accept defeat four years ago, sparked a violent insurrection at the US Capitol, was convicted of felony charges and survived two assassination attempts.

With a win in Wisconsin, Trump cleared the 270 electoral votes needed to clinch the presidency. The victory validates his bare-knuckle approach to politics. He attacked his Democratic rival, Kamala Harris, in deeply personal often misogynistic and racistterms as he pushed an apocalyptic picture of a country overrun by violent migrants. The rhetoric, paired with an image of hypermasculinity, resonated with angry voters particularly menin a deeply polarised nation.

"I want to thank the American people for the extraordinary honour of being elected your 47th president and your 45th president," Trump told cheering supporters in Florida.

Trump's win after a gap of four years is also spectacular in the sense that only one other American president has secured two non-consecutive terms. Grover Cleveland, the 22nd and 24th president, served as the US president between 1885-1889 and 1893-1897.
